A case study evaluating the portability of an executable computable phenotype algorithm across multiple institutions and electronic health record environments.
Journal of the American Medical Informatics Association : JAMIA - 1 Nov 2018
Pacheco Jennifer A, Rasmussen Luke V, Kiefer Richard C, Campion Thomas R, Speltz Peter, Carroll Robert J, Stallings Sarah C, Mo Huan, Ahuja Monika, Jiang Guoqian, LaRose Eric R, Peissig Peggy L, Shang Ning, Benoit Barbara, Gainer Vivian S, Borthwick Kenneth, Jackson Kathryn L, Sharma Ambrish, Wu Andy Yizhou, Kho Abel N, Roden Dan M, Pathak Jyotishman, Denny Joshua C, Thompson William K
Abstract excerpt
Electronic health record (EHR) algorithms for defining patient cohorts are commonly shared as free-text descriptions that require human intervention both to interpret and implement. We developed the Phenotype Execution and Modeling Architecture (PhEMA, http://projectphema.org) to author and execute standardized computable phenotype algorithms.
